I have been planning to do a Peacock Bass fishing trip for some time now and it finally happened! A lot of research was involved in planning this trip and ensuring we found the fish we were targeting. Most videos I came across on YouTube did not disclose their exact location, so it was no guarantee we'd even be in the right body of water. We loaded up the boat and headed to Naples hoping to find THE SPOT. The first place we found was the exact same spot that I had seen in videos days before our trip, so I knew they were at least here! It was incredible to see how natural everything was down here, from the lime rock shore to the thick vegetation under water. The waterways here just seemed untouched and lively. We used a ton of artificial lures and had no luck. Fortunately we brought out a couple dozen shiners which seemed to be the only thing the fish were interested in. The bite was definitely off for most of the day, to the point where the fish wouldn't even touch a live shiner. We were able to land 4 Peacocks with my PB being 3.95 lbs. We were really hoping to hook into some snakeheads on this trip but didn't have any luck. We will be planning a trip further south into the Everglades to target Peacocks and Snakeheads.
